The game has been around for ages, played by scholars and intellectuals. When playing chess, the first moves in the opening stage are the most important and that is why this guide will help you learn to innovate strategies that will help you not only enjoy defeating your opponents but also set your game up for success from the word go and help you benefit from the associated benefits to your mind.

It includes:

  • The primary history of chess

  • A brief introduction to the chessboard and pieces

  • Beginners strategies for opening, middle, and end game

  • Advanced strategies for opening, middle, and end game

  • The secret strategies and tactics of botvinnik that have made him the undisputed champion

  • The psychology to win in chess with the right mindset

In other words, this book will very simply teach you best opening practices and go over the ones you are most likely to encounter when playing the game. It will also give you all the information you need in order to know which opening to play under which circumstances. Furthermore, it will help you develop your own playing style based on sound openings that have been analyzed and tested for centuries by the brightest minds to ever play the game.
